How to Apply
Admission to Program
*In an effort to meet the goals of Project Mosaic, priority admission will be given to eligible candidates seeking the Autism Spectrum Certificate in combination with the
Clear Level II Education Specialist credential (K-12) and Master of Arts in Special Education, respectively.
Preconditions
Applicants are required to meet standards for a master's degree program in special education or provide evidence of an advanced graduate training degree in special education or a related field
Applicants who wish to concurrently pursue the Professional Level II Education Specialist Credential with the Autism Spectrum Certificate and/or Master of Arts degree must complete all Level I coursework prior to certificate coursework
Applicants must complete or have completed a Department of Special Education application, which includes the following:
  • Demonstrate a minimum 3.0 GPA for admission
  • Two current professional letters of reference
  • Current resume
  • Statement of purpose documenting interest in the program and any relevant experience
An interview with program faculty may be included upon request
Application Procedures
Continuing Students
(Matriculated M.A. degree, and attending any program area in special education)

Submit to Department of Special Education Office (BH 156)

  1. Statement of purpose documenting interest in Autism program and relevant experience
  2. Unofficial SFSU transcript (download from MySFSU)
New Students
Complete the following by the application deadlines
(March 15 for Fall / October 15 for Spring)
  1. CSUMentor application and
  2. Department of Special Education application
